Join us in celebrating public lands during our National Public Lands Day event! Take part in our pine pulling contest (with prizes!), all while learning about the sensitive species found in Point Arena, the danger of the invasive pine encroachment, and ongoing restoration efforts. The volunteer project will focus on removing invasive pines along the coastal trails. You can volunteer for any length of time. No prior registration required. Volunteer registration will be at the BLM booth at the Point Arena City Hall from 8:00am-11:00am. Volunteers are welcome to show up any time between 8:00am and 11:00am. Volunteers are not required to volunteer for the whole 3 hours. This volunteer event will be taking place during the Point Arena-Stornetta Celebrate the Coast event. The event will have tons of educational booths, talks, displays, guided walks, and activities, all of which will be focused on the cultural, biological, and natural resources found within Point Arena-Stornetta. Volunteers are welcome to enjoy this free event!

During the volunteer project, volunteers will get the opportunity to learn about the biodiversity, native species, and invasive species threats to Point Arena, as well as get their hands dirty and make an important impact in protecting the landscape.
